I just took a 3-section PT on LawHub but chose to take the second LR section instead of the first -- I didn't realize that the Flex Simulator automatically removes the second LR section. I really want to log my results for this Flex PT onto 7Sage, so is there a way somehow for me to choose to include the second LR section instead of the first? The obvious answer seems to be no but maybe putting my question out there can lead to an update that allows users to choose which LR to include.

    Hi @zuligarmar666 and @juliet7sage.Fondue,

    Sorry, we do not have the option to choose which LR section is skipped when simulating Flex mode. However, I will pass your request on to my team.

    Note that if you would like both LR sections to be reflected in your Analytics, you can take a 4-section PrepTest, and then use our Flex Score Convertor to estimate your score with only 3 sections.
